Do you have to be a ZIN member to teach Zumba?
Top Benefits of Being a ZIN Member -With ZIN, you keep your license indefinitely as long as you’re paying each month. Without ZIN, you have to re-license in a year to keep teaching (which is $200 + ).
How much money can you make as a Zumba instructor?
Zumba Instructors in America make an average salary of $42,566 per year or $20 per hour. The top 10 percent makes over $62,000 per year, while the bottom 10 percent under $28,000 per year.

How long does it take to learn Zumba?
The entire Zumba certification process typically takes anywhere from a full day to an entire weekend and doesn’t require any pre-requisites so as long as you’re over 18, you’re good to go. Right now, you’re able to get your certification online through a 10-hour program you can take at your own pace.

Do Zumba instructors make up their own choreography?
Some Zumba instructors will come up with their own routines. The most common Zumba dance moves or dance steps are called mambas, V-steps, exaggerated hips, cha-cha-chas, and side touches. Zumba classes repeat the same songs so you will get used to it after awhile.

What makes a great Zumba instructor?
To be a good Zumba instructor, master the techniques of Zumba workouts and learn how to modify your instruction to compensate for students’ varying abilities. Have a high-energy and encouraging teaching style, making classes fun yet challenging. Be aware of any issues your students may have during class.

Can beginners do Zumba?
Zumba is designed to allow beginners and advanced dancers to attend the same classes, though your gym or fitness center may offer classes geared toward beginners.
